Abstract

In 2009,China has become the 2nd largest diamond consuming contry in the world. The Chinese gemmologists have been facing more and more identification and research challengings for various treated and synthetic diamonds. Here,recent development on the identification and research of diamonds in the world are reviewed. The gemmological identification characteristics for the different diamonds treated by multiple processes are provided.
